A Vacancy at Rotherham Doncaster and South Humber NHS Foundation Trust.
We are seeking a highly motivated, enthusiastic Medical Secretary to join our admin team within the Rehabilitation Directorate. This is a permanent position, 37.5 hours per week, working Monday to Friday, based at Tickhill Road Hospital.
The successful candidate will be reliable and capable of providing confidential, high-quality administrative and telephone services. Attention to detail is essential, along with the ability to work collaboratively within the team and support and mentor colleagues. Applicants should have excellent oral and written communication skills and be able to interact professionally with people at all levels.
If you do not already possess a Level 3 qualification or equivalent experience in a relevant subject, RDaSH offers this post alongside the opportunity to complete a Level 3 apprenticeship qualification relevant to your role. As an apprentice, you will gain valuable experience, develop work-related skills, and obtain a nationally recognized qualification through regular training with a college or training organization. Approximately 20% of your working hours will be dedicated to training or studying.
Whether you are already employed by us or new to the NHS, apprenticeships can help you develop the skills, knowledge, and expertise needed for a successful career in health services.
RDaSH employs around 4,000 talented colleagues who are valued and respected. Our services include mental health, physical health, learning disability, and drug and alcohol services. We are committed to staff development, hosting monthly learning half-days, and fostering an inclusive culture. We aim to attract and retain staff who share our passion for providing first-class care.
